| Objective:To summarize the clinical characteristics of trauma patients in emergency department and analyze the risk factors related to death and to provide reference for the prevention and treatment of traumatic diseases.Methods:A retrospective study was conducted to select the clinical data of trauma patients admitted in our hospital from January 1,2017to December 31,2019.The epidemiological characteristics of clinical data such as basic information,diagnosis and treatment process and out come were analyzed.SPSS 23 was used to analyze the data.The line chart model is constructed based on the results of multi-factor logistic regression analysis.Results:A total of 679 patients were included in this study,including 488 males and 191 females.The mean age was 45.82±18.39years.Traffic injury(60.5%)was the main cause of injury.The second was falling injury(14.9%).Limbs(66.9%)were the most common injury sites.Multiple injuries were 390 cases(57.4%);The peak time of injury is 9-11,16-18 and 20-21;The peak time of emergency is 12-14and 19-23;A single site had the highest risk of death from severe trauma;Univariate analysis results showed that blood pressure,respiratory rate,shock index,Lac,PO2,Fi O2 and ISS scores were related risk factors for death,Lac,PO2 and ISS scores were independent risk factors for death.The above risk factors were used to build a prediction model and demonstrated by a histogram.ROC Curve analysis showed that the Area under the Curve(AUC)of the histograph model in predicting the risk of death of trauma patients was 0.897,and the predictive power was significantly higher than that of LAC(AUC=0.853),PO2(AUC=0.680)and ISS score(AUC=0.768),all P<0.001.The model calibration diagram shows that the predicted probability is consistent with the actual probability.Conclusion:Young and middle-aged male patients were the mainly population.Summer and autumn are the seasons with a high incidence of admission of trauma patients through emergency approach in our hospital,and the peak periods of emergency trauma patients are 12 to14 and 19 to 23.The most common site of trauma was the extremities,and the main cause of injury was traffic injury.Lac value,Pa O2 and ISS score were independent risk factors of death. |
